    What Exactly Is a Form 8-K?

    Form 8-K

    A Form 8K is a report used to provide public notification of any unanticipated events or changes that are significant to the operational performance or continued existence of a company. For this reason, both the company’s stockholders and the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) regard it as vital. These kinds of occurrences include things like the departure of corporate directors, the purchase of new property, the declaration of bankruptcy, and the modification of the fiscal year.     Requirements for a Form 8-K

    Requirements

    For most report events, a Form 8-K must be filed immediately, usually within four business days following the event. Depending on what is being shared, different information is needed. For instance, a company must report a bankruptcy or receivership before filing subsequent 8-Ks explaining the plan for reorganization or liquidation and the court’s approval of that plan. These 8-Ks will be accessible to investors via the SEC’s EDGAR website, which makes 8-Ks publicly available. Using the reports, investors can determine if their stock is likely to be canceled or if the company is expected to be released from receivership soon. 

    In addition, the completion of acquisition or disposition of assets is another instance found in the field of mergers and acquisitions. This covers acquisitions and corporate mergers. The corporation must thoroughly outline the terms of the transaction for this item.


    How to Read a Form 8-K

    Form 8-K

    The name and description of the significant event, as well as any exhibits that are relevant such as a financial statement, are the only sections of a Form 8-K. If you want to read it, all you have to do is browse through the form to find the trigger event and explanation, as well as any supporting documents and materials. The information that is included in Form 8-k is quite easy to read. This is because their primary purpose is to offer investors the data and context they need to make educated judgments in the aftermath of a significant event. The Investor Bulletin on How to Read an 8-K that is published by the SEC emphasizes a number of disclosures on an 8-K that investors could find to be useful.


    Advantages of a Form 8-K

    Form 8-K

    Form 8-K provides the effective and timely notification of important changes.

    First of all, a Form 8-K provides investors with timely notification of material developments at publicly traded corporations. The SEC defines a number of these alterations in detail. In contrast, others are merely events that companies deem sufficiently significant. Regardless, the form allows companies to engage directly with investors. There is no filtering or alteration of the material by media organizations. In addition, investors do not need to watch television, subscribe to periodicals, or sift through financial news websites in order to obtain the 8-K.

    Management of the company can avoid concerns of insider trading.

    Form 8-K also provides significant benefits to publicly traded corporations. The company’s management can meet particular disclosure standards and prevent insider trading claims by timely filing an 8-K. Companies can also utilize Form 8-K to notify investors about any significant occurrences.

    It is a useful record for economic researchers.

    Lastly, Form 8-K serves as an important record for economic researchers. Academics, for example, may be curious about the impact of various events on stock values. Regressions can be used to evaluate the influence of these occurrences, but researchers need credible data. Since 8-K disclosures are required by law, they give a complete record and help to avoid sample selection bias.


    Disadvantages of a Form 8-K

    Form 8-K

    Companies have to pay for a Form 8-K.

    Form 8-K, like other legally mandated forms, imposes costs on businesses. There is the cost of preparing and submitting the paperwork, as well as the possibility of fines for late filing. Although it is only a minor portion of the issue, the requirement to submit Form 8-K discourages small businesses from going public in the first place. Requiring corporations to share information assists investors in making better decisions. However, when the burden on enterprises gets too great, it might limit their investment possibilities.
